I MIGRATED MUSIC AND PHOTOS FROM PC TO NEW IMAC VIA ETHERNET/MIGRATION ASSISTANT. IT SAID that job was completed but i cannot find anyof my stuff. where is it?

i cannot find music, photos or documents after migrating from pc to new imac. both computers said transfer was successful but i cannot find anything. where is it?

It went to a new user Account.
Go to: Apple > System Preferences > Users & Groups to see the new Account.
For more info, see > About Windows Migration Assistant
Notes
This process will create a new user account on your Mac that contains the data migrated from the Windows PC.  It will not merge the information with any existing user accounts on your Mac.
This article only applies to migrating from a Windows-based PC to a Mac. For assistance with performing a migration from one Mac to another, please see How to use Migration Assistant to transfer files from another Mac.
Windows-specific file types, such as .exe files, are not transferred.
You will need to enter your password when you first use an account, such as when you use your transferred email account in the Mail application for the first time.

  • I used Migration Assistant to transfer my iTunes from pc to mac.  Everything seemed to work fine and it took 15 hours and said that it was successful, but I cannot find my music on my mac?

    Any advice would be apprecitated.
    Thanks

    System Preferences/Users & Groups shows you the various user accounts you have.
    Look at your hard drive in the Finder sidebar. You should see Applications, Library, System, and Users. If you look in Users you will see a Shared folder. From the user Migration Assistant created, find the iTunes folder and drag it to Shared. Log out and log in using your normal user account, go to the same place and copy it to Music in your normal user account. Another option is to leave it in shared so any user can access it. You will have to tell iTunes where to find the music by going to iTunes/Preferences/Advanced.

  • How do I delete music and photos from my iCloud account? I've read below that you can't. Really? Is that correct?

    How do I delete music and photos from my iCloud account? I've read that you can't. Really? Is that true?

    You can delete photo stream photos from iCloud by just deleting them on your iPod.  My photo stream photos are automatically deleted from iCloud after 30 days anyway.  Just so you are aware, deleting photo stream photos doesn't free up any space in your account as they don't use your personal iCloud account storage.
    You can't delete music from iCloud because the music isn't stored in your account; it's stored in the iTunes store.  What you are seeing are links to your previously purchased music in the iTuens store, allowing you to redownload them if you want to.  You can't remove anything from your list of previous purchases.  If you don't want to see these "iTunes in the Cloud" purchases in your song list, go to Settings>iTunes & App Store and turn off Music under Show All.  LIke photo stream photos, this music doesn't use any of your personal iCloud account storage.

  • I have a new iMac - how do file share my music and photos from my old mac to my new mac?

    I want to transfer my music and photos from one Mac to another - but I don't want to transfer anything else - what is the best way to do this?
    Thanks

    the simplest way would be to connect the two Macs with a firewire cable, boot the source Mac in Target Disk Mode, and copy the entire iTunes folder (not just the iTunes music folder) from /users//music on the source to /users//music on the target (overwriting the iTunes folder in place there).
    do the same with your iPhoto library. see this support article for more information (except, you won't have to option-launch iPhoto)

  • How do I transfer music and photos from my iPhone 4s to my iPad

    HHow do I transfer music and photos from my iPhone 4s to my ipad

    You cannot directly transfer anything from an iPhone to an iPad. If your iPad is signed onto the same Apple ID as your iPhone in Settings>iTunes & App Store, then it has access to the same Music library as your phone. Click on the More tab in the iTunes App on your iPad, and then on Purchased, Not on this iPad to see all of the music available to download to the iPad. You can also set the "Automatic Downloads" option to ON in Settings>iTunes & App Store and going forward, any music you purchase on the iPhone or via iTunes on a computer will automatically download to your iPad. Set the same setting on the iPhone to have it do the same.
    As for photos. If both the iPhone and iPad are signed onto the same iCloud ID in Settings>iCloud, then turn on Photo Stream on both the iPad and iPhone to share Photo Stream photos between the two devices. Photos on your Camera Roll that are no longer on Photo Stream, or photos in other Photo Albums would have to be sync'd to the iPad via iTunes on the computer you sync with (assuming you have imported your photos to that computer).

  • My mac book pro crashed and lost all my data.  Can I re-install my music and photos from my ipad?  how do I do that

    Can I reinstall music and photos from my ipad

    Hi Stephen,
    You'd need to use a 3rd party program to remove the content off your iPad, iTunes is only designed to sync purchased content off the iPad (content that was purchased on the iPad). There are several 3rd party offerings, a popular one is called Senuti.
